Using Volocity, cytosolic Ca2+ alterations were monitored using the ratiometric dye, fura-2 AM. In response to the mitochondrial uncoupler FCCP and NMDA, leakage of mitochondrial Ca2+ from mitochondria is observed in hippocampal cultures, accompanied by an increased cytosolic Ca2+ concentration. Image courtesy of Dr. Bettina Platt, University of Aberdeen.
Ratiometric images can be acquired using Volocity Acquisition our advanced 3D image capture software. Volocity Quantitation has a wide variety of tools which can be used to import and analyze ratiometric images from any source. Our Ratio Plugin software is required to optimize both Volocity Acquisition and Quantitation, providing you with a fully on-line 3D ratiometric imaging solution.
Your results are stored in a ‘Measurement Item’ which automatically charts the intensity values from the ROIs selected as well as providing the raw data for further analysis. The image data can be reanalyzed as required by using the ratio measurement features in Volocity Quantitation. Charts and data can be exported and used for publication.
Recent advances in Volocity have added a new dimension to your ratio imaging by providing the software tools required to perform ratio imaging in three dimensions. The Ratio Plugin allows the creation of 3D acquisition protocols that can capture ratio image pairs at high speed and in Z. In the live Video preview, a live graphical plot of each ROI is provided, with each ROI shown in a different color for ease of navigation. You have the option to view one acquisition channel at a time, or you can choose to see acquisition channels, plus the ratioed image with a rainbow CLUT (Color Look Up Table) applied and the intensity modulated channel, all at the same time. These two feedback features allows you to follow the course of your experiment in real time and monitor events to make sure that your protocol is working correctly.
